Apple as we speak filed a patent infringement lawsuit in opposition to AliveCor, an organization that has developed the ECG “KardiaBand” designed for the Apple Watch, amongst different ECG-focused merchandise. AliveCor and Apple are already within the midst of a authorized battle following an ITC criticism and antitrust lawsuit that AliveCor filed final yr
In line with Apple, AliveCor’s product line has not been profitable with clients, and the corporate’s “failures out there” have led it to “opportunistic assertions of its patents in opposition to Apple.” Earlier this yr, AliveCor submitted an Worldwide Commerce Fee criticism in opposition to Apple in an try and get an import ban on the Apple Watch, and the choose dominated in AliveCor’s favor.
Apple says that whereas it’s interesting the ruling, it’s utilizing this new patent infringement submitting to “set the file straight as to who’s the actual pioneer,” placing a cease to AliveCor’s “rampant infringement than unlawfully appropriates Apple’s mental property.” From the submitting:
Apple is the pioneering innovator, having researched, developed, and patented core, foundational applied sciences earlier than AliveCor got here into existence. AliveCor’s litigation marketing campaign is nothing greater than an try and siphon from the success of Apple applied sciences it didn’t invent, all of the whereas promoting merchandise that depend on foundational ECG improvements that Apple patented years earlier than AliveCor got here to be.
The criticism cites a number of Apple patents associated to the center price and ECG performance within the Apple Watch, which Apple says AliveCor’s KardiaMobile, KardiaMobile Card, and Kardia app infringe on.
Apple claims that AliveCor’s patent infringements are inflicting Apple irreparable hurt, with Apple aiming for a everlasting injunction to cease additional infringement, in addition to damages and authorized charges.
AliveCor first filed an antitrust swimsuit in opposition to Apple again in Might 2021, accusing Apple of “monopolistic conduct” for the launch of the ECG performance within the Apple Watch. AliveCor claims that Apple noticed the success of its KardiaBand and determined to “nook the marketplace for coronary heart price evaluation on Apple Watch.”
The corporate has additionally filed patent infringement lawsuits accusing Apple of coping AliveCor’s cardiological detection and evaluation expertise.
